Which guidelines dictate the appropriate swimwear for patrons?

Swimwear guidelines for patrons are primarily encompassed by the concept of Patron Bathing Attire. This terminology refers specifically to the types of clothing that are deemed acceptable in aquatic environments, ensuring they are appropriate for swimming and do not pose health or safety risks. By setting standards for bathing attire, facilities can maintain hygiene and comfort, ensuring that swimwear is suitable for both recreational and competitive use, while also considering factors such as fabric type and coverage.

While other options like Health Department Regulations may provide overarching safety guidelines, they do not focus specifically on swimwear standards. Aquatic Center Policies may include rules around clothing, but they are often broader and can vary from one facility to another. Patron Clothing Standards is a more general term and might not specifically address swimwear. Therefore, Patron Bathing Attire is the most precise and relevant choice for establishing appropriate swimwear guidelines for aquatic facility patrons.
